vps之间如何传输文件

VPS之间如何传输文件

在互联网时代,VPS(虚拟专用服务器)已经成为了许多企业和个人的首选,VPS具有高性价比、灵活性、安全性等优点,使得它在各种场景中得到了广泛的应用,对于初学者来说,VPS之间的文件传输可能会成为一个难题,本文将详细介绍如何在VPS之间传输文件,帮助大家轻松解决问题。

使用SCP命令传输文件

SCP(Secure Copy Protocol)是一种基于SSH协议的安全文件传输工具,可以在本地和远程服务器之间进行文件传输,在VPS之间传输文件时,我们可以使用SCP命令来实现,以下是使用SCP命令传输文件的基本步骤:

1、打开终端:在Linux系统中,可以通过快捷键Ctrl+Alt+T打开终端;在Windows系统中,可以通过“开始”菜单找到“命令提示符”或“PowerShell”。

2、输入SCP命令:在终端中输入以下命令,将本地文件传输到远程服务器:

scp /path/to/local/file username@remote_ip:/path/to/remote/directory

/path/to/local/file是本地文件的路径,username是远程服务器的用户名,remote_ip是远程服务器的IP地址,/path/to/remote/directory是远程服务器上的目标目录。

3、输入密码:在执行SCP命令后,系统会提示输入远程服务器的密码,输入正确的密码后,文件传输将开始。

4、检查文件传输状态:在文件传输过程中,终端会显示实时的传输进度和速度信息,传输完成后,本地文件将被上传到远程服务器指定的目录。

使用SFTP客户端传输文件

除了使用SCP命令外,还可以使用SFTP(SSH File Transfer Protocol)客户端来进行文件传输,SFTP是一个基于SSH协议的安全文件传输工具,功能与SCP类似,以下是使用SFTP客户端传输文件的基本步骤:

1、下载并安装SFTP客户端:在Linux系统中,可以使用系统的包管理器(如apt、yum等)安装OpenSSH客户端;在Windows系统中,可以下载并安装第三方SFTP客户端,如FileZilla、WinSCP等。

2、连接到远程服务器:打开SFTP客户端,输入远程服务器的IP地址、端口号、用户名和密码,然后点击“连接”按钮,连接成功后,客户端将显示远程服务器的文件列表。

3、选择要传输的文件:在远程服务器的文件列表中,选择要传输的文件,然后将其拖放到本地计算机的目标目录中,或者右键点击选中的文件,选择“下载”或“上传”操作。

4、检查文件传输状态:在文件传输过程中,SFTP客户端会显示实时的传输进度和速度信息,传输完成后,本地计算机将拥有远程服务器上的文件副本。

使用rsync命令传输文件

rsync(Remote Synchronization)是一种高效的文件同步工具,可以在本地和远程服务器之间进行文件同步,通过使用rsync命令,我们可以将VPS之间的文件同步到一个中心位置,从而实现跨平台、跨网络的文件传输,以下是使用rsync命令传输文件的基本步骤:

1、安装rsync:在Linux系统中,可以通过包管理器(如apt、yum等)安装rsync;在Windows系统中,可以下载并安装第三方rsync工具,如Cygwin、Git Bash等。

2、配置同步源和目标目录:在本地计算机上创建一个用于同步的目录,然后在该目录下运行rsync -avz --delete /path/to/source/directory username@remote_ip:/path/to/destination/directory命令。/path/to/source/directory是本地计算机上的源目录,username是远程服务器的用户名,remote_ip是远程服务器的IP地址,/path/to/destination/directory是远程服务器上的目标目录,此命令将把源目录中的文件同步到目标目录中,并删除目标目录中不存在于源目录的文件。

3、检查同步状态:在同步过程中,终端会显示实时的同步进度和速度信息,同步完成后,本地计算机将拥有远程服务器上的文件副本,如果需要停止同步,可以按Ctrl+C组合键中断rsync进程。

相关问题与解答:

1、VPS之间的网络延迟会影响文件传输速度吗?答:是的,VPS之间的网络延迟会影响文件传输速度,为了提高传输速度,可以选择距离较近的VPS进行文件传输;还可以通过优化网络环境、调整传输参数等方式来提高传输速度。

2、VPS之间的文件同步是如何工作的?答:VPS之间的文件同步是通过rsync命令实现的,rsync命令会在两个目录之间建立一个增量备份机制,只传输发生变化的部分,从而提高同步效率,rsync还可以设置同步策略、过滤规则等参数,以满足不同场景下的同步需求。

分享文章:vps之间如何传输文件
文章链接:http://www.shufengxianlan.com/qtweb/news39/462539.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联